This is a broken Sher-Wood hockey stick used by Tacoma Sabercats left wing Kim Maier. The stick is the 9950 Iron Carbon model for a right-handed shooter. The stick was broken about a foot from the angle of the stick. Maier played 206 regular-season games over four seasons for the Sabercats from 1997-2001. Maier’s best season was 1997-98 when he had 56 goals, 47 assists and 103 points in 55 regular-season games. He added six goals and 11 assists in 12 playoff games as the Sabercats advanced to the West Coast Hockey League finals.
